THE SNP have challenged Keir Starmer to reform Westminster’s welfare system following recent comments made by ex-prime minister Gordon Brown.
The two-child cap prevents parents from claiming child tax credit or Universal Credit for any third or subsequent child born after 2017.have also previously been urged to scrap the “rape clause” – an exemption offered as part of the two-child cap for families where a third child was conceived as a result of rape but only if they can offer proof.
“Now, at a time when people are really suffering in a cost of living crisis, the Labour leadership have shockingly known that they won’t do anything differently from the Tories to create a fairer UK welfare system.”
